I'm sure everyone has had a "I blew it" type moment that caused you to not get your potentially biggest buck, deer you were after, etc. If you haven't then keep hunting!
Mine was opening day of Ky rifle in 2004. I was sitting in a ladder stand overlooking a cut CRP field with a pretty deep woods behind me. About an hour after daylight I heard something behind me and just a hair to the right. I turned to look and the biggest buck I'd ever laid eyes on at the time was standing 30 yards away. This is going to sound crazy but I was in a 14' ladder stand and I swear on everything he seen me before I seen him and instead of running was trying to skirt past me real slow. The only thing I heard was one twig break and when I turned he was cutting his eyes at me. Call me crazy but that's how it was. I quickly got turned and on him and BOOM. I knew immediately I had missed and was thinking how the heck did that happen. He crossed the field at about 100 yards doing 100 mph and I popped another shot at him that probably didn't get within 20 feet of him. I was plum sick about it. About 30 minutes later another guy killed him on the backside of the property. He was a solid 9 point and all I can remember about him is all the mass. Don't remember how good the tines were but he had tons of mass. I'm guessing he was a 140-150" deer but at the time wasn't into the scoring game.
